  • the invention relates to a light source for a lamp with a socket body and a socket cover, the socket cover on the one hand, the arrangement of the socket in a light and on the other hand has latching means which engage releasably in counter-locking means of the socket body and wherein the socket housing has connection contacts for connecting lines and an operating electronics carries, which serves to control a lamp held in the socket.
  • Sockets for generic bulbs are shown for example in the catalog of the applicant 2008 - 2011, Section 3, "Sockets for compact fluorescent lamps" page 39 and 40 and are offered for example under the item number 26.103. These sockets correspond to the type G24 or GX24 and have an integrated control gear for compact fluorescent lamps to be used.
  • Such bulbs are used in addition to the general living room lighting, especially in the field of gastronomy and hotel lighting.
  • the gastronomy and hotel industry often aligns their homes with luminaires designed for a specific ambience. These lights are usually found in every building in a company and contribute - among other, style-forming elements - to a certain recognition of the customer.
  • incandescent lamps were often replaced by compact fluorescent lamps, so-called “retro-fit lamps”. This led to the problem that lamps with integrated ballast and in combination with an Edison charged due to their size not in the on Incandescent lamps based lights could be used. In addition, it occasionally came to the theft of comparatively expensive compact fluorescent lamps or to replace incandescent lamps for example by hotel guests.
  • the object of the invention is therefore to provide a new light source for retrofitting existing lights or for equipping new lights, which has the advantages of the known versions and compact fluorescent lamps and meets the requirements of modern LED light sources.
  • the socket body carries an LED lamp and is provided with an integrated heat sink, which dissipates the heat of operation of a heat conducting element of the LED light source.
  • This light source first ensures that the operating heat of the LED light source is sufficiently dissipated, which is a prerequisite for a long life of the LED. Due to the supported by the socket body operating electronics, small-sized LED light sources can be used. The proposed invention solution does not require more space than a commercial incandescent lamp. Thus, the retrofitting of existing lights is not a problem. Due to the non-existent standard base / socket systems, the theft risk for the LED light source is low.
  • EP 2163808A1 DE 20 2009 017728 U1 and US 2006 / 0227558A1 are known LED lamps, which are provided for use in standard Edison sockets with a corresponding threaded socket. These lamps adheres to the aforementioned disadvantage that the size usually does not correspond to the lamp to be replaced. In addition, there is also the danger here that these high-quality aftermarket lamps are exchanged unauthorized against standard lamps.
  • FR 2923286 also shows an LED lamp, which serves to retrofit known versions. Instead of a lamp cap with Edison thread, the lamp disclosed there is provided with a two-pin base. Such bulbs are known as "retro-fit lamps”.
  • a high cooling capacity with simple frame production is the main advantage of this embodiment.
  • the socket body is provided at least in sections with externally circumferential, extending in the circumferential direction cooling fins. This fin arrangement promotes air circulation between the ribs in a horizontal illuminant arrangement in a luminaire.
  • a first variant of the aforementioned embodiment is characterized in that the lighting means with a standardized External thread - for example, according to IEC standard 60399 - is provided, which in conjunction with Matterringen the holder of lighting parts, such as lampshades, and additionally has the function of surface enlarging cooling fins, especially if the thread of the socket is reduced compared to the threaded inner diameter of the coupling ring core size has, so that the threaded ridge has an enlarged surface to promote the heat dissipation.
  • the socket body is provided externally circumferentially with lampslijnsaxial cooling fins, especially if the radially directed outer surfaces of the cooling fins with threaded portions of a standardized external thread - for example, according to IEC standard 60399 - are provided, which in cooperation with coupling rings of the holder of lighting parts, like lampshades, serves.
  • This cooling rib arrangement promotes air circulation with lamps arranged vertically in a luminaire.
  • the LED and the socket form a non-destructively non-separable unit.
  • This has the significant advantage that the frame manufacturer is responsible for the assembly of the LED and makes this professional.
  • a defined contact pressure between the LED light source, in particular its heat-conducting element, and the socket-side heat sink is important in order to ensure a sufficient heat transfer.
  • the socket housing and the LED form a preassembled, structural unit, which is possibly separable using a special tool.
  • the design of the light source as a structural unit of lamp and socket can be realized in particular by an identically dimensioned life of the operating electronics and LED. Since the technical design and the installation of the LED is carried out by the socket manufacturer, this can ensure the manufacturing quality of the light source.
  • the LED with the interposition of a film provided with conductor tracks, is applied directly to a carrier area formed by the socket housing.
  • the operating electronics for the LED forms an assembly unit with the LED itself.
  • the coupling ring is designed as an additional heat sink or serves as a thermal bridge for dissipating the heat from the socket body to other parts of the lamp.
  • the socket body has a connection for a protective conductor. This is initially advantageous for the production, since more favorable requirements are placed on the electrical insulation when grounding the socket body.
  • the grounded socket body protects the operating electronics to control the LED from electromagnetic interference. Furthermore, sensitive electrical appliances are protected by a grounded socket body against electromagnetic fields of the operating electronics of the LED.

  • an LED 18 is shown, in which the actual photoelectric element is arranged on a circuit board.
  • Such LEDs 18 are available as standard components, wherein the board is usually an aluminum body, which serves as a heat conducting element for heat dissipation of the LED 18 to a downstream heat sink.
  • a socket body 11 is provided, which is intended for use in residential lighting, especially for the use of gastronomy and hotel lighting.
  • the currently widely used, intended for compact fluorescent lamps versions can be replaced accordingly and the lights are equipped with small-sized LED light sources. Since the operating electronics are carried by the socket body 11 itself, the bulbs are no larger than the conventionally used Edison lamps. There is even the possibility to make the bulbs more compact. In the event that the LED light source fails, it is easily interchangeable by skilled workers with tools.
  • the advantages of the prior art are retained. The conversion is easy and the theft of the comparatively high quality lamps is low due to the lack of simple screw mounting.
  • the particularly preferred embodiment of the invention is characterized in that the LED light source and the socket body 11 form a possibly with a special tool, but preferably non-destructively non-separable unit. Since the dissipation of the operating heat of LEDs is of essential importance in order to realize the theoretically achievable operating life, care is taken by the manufacturer for a correct design and mounting of the LED on the socket body 11 functioning as a heat sink. It depends in particular on the correct contact pressure between the LED own board and the socket body 11 in order to ensure a good heat transfer. Considering these circumstances, since the life of the LED corresponds to that of the operating electronics, the possibility of a component replacement does not matter. A defective bulb 10 is completely replaced accordingly. This can be easily accomplished by the use of existing in the lights and from the prior art well-known and correspondingly standardized socket covers.
  • the use of LEDs which already carry the operating electronics on their board, offers further significant advantages.
  • the assembly is simplified because a separate operating device is not required.

Claims (12)

  1. Moyen d'éclairage (10) pour une lampe avec un corps de monture (11) qui porte un appareil de fonctionnement (14) avec une électronique de fonctionnement, et avec un capot de monture (16), le capot de monture (16) servant d'une part à l'agencement du corps de monture (11) dans une lampe et présentant d'autre part des moyens d'encliquetage, qui s'engagent de façon amovible dans des moyens de contre-encliquetage du corps de monture (11), et le corps de monture (11) présentant des contacts de raccordement pour des lignes de raccordement et l'électronique de fonctionnement servant à l'activation d'une lampe maintenue par le corps de monture (11), le corps de monture (11) portant une source lumineuse à DEL et étant muni d'un corps de refroidissement intégré, qui évacue la chaleur de service d'un élément conducteur de chaleur de la source lumineuse à DEL, et la DEL (18) disposée sur une platine étant montée sur le côté opposé du capot de monture (16) du corps de monture (11), dont les fils de raccordement (19) sont reliés à l'appareil de fonctionnement (14).
  2. Moyen d'éclairage selon la revendication 1, caractérisé en ce que le corps de monture (11) est conçu lui-même en tant que corps de refroidissement.
  3. Moyen d'éclairage selon la revendication 1 ou 2, caractérisé en ce que le corps de monture (11) est muni, au moins par sections, d'ailettes de refroidissement placées dans la direction de la circonférence, sur la périphérie extérieure.
  4. Moyen d'éclairage selon l'une des revendications 1 à 3, caractérisé en ce que le corps de monture (11) est muni d'un filetage extérieur (35) standardisé, par exemple suivant la norme CEI 60399, lequel sert en coopération avec des bagues d'accouplement (22) de maintien des pièces de la lampe, comme des abat-jour, et possède, en plus, la fonction d'ailettes de refroidissement augmentant la surface.
  5. Moyen d'éclairage selon la revendication 4, caractérisé en ce que le filetage extérieur (35) du corps de monture (11) présente une mesure de noyau réduite par rapport au diamètre intérieur du filet de la bague d'accouplement (22), de sorte que le filet présente une surface agrandie pour l'acheminement de l'évacuation de chaleur.
  6. Moyen d'éclairage selon la revendication 1 ou 2, caractérisé en ce que le corps de monture (11) est muni, sur la périphérie extérieure, d'ailettes de refroidissement (25) orientées dans le sens longitudinal axial de la lampe.
  7. Moyen d'éclairage selon la revendication 6, caractérisé en ce que les surfaces extérieures, orientées radialement, des ailettes de refroidissement (25) orientées dans le sens longitudinal axial de la lampe sont munies de segments filetés d'un filetage extérieur (35) standardisé, par exemple suivant la norme CEI 60399, lequel sert, en coopération avec des bagues d'accouplement (22), de maintien des pièces de la lampe, comme des abat-jour.
  8. Moyen d'éclairage selon l'une des précédentes revendications, caractérisé en ce que le corps de monture (11) et la source lumineuse à DEL forment une unité constructive, non séparable, sans endommagement.
  9. Moyen d'éclairage selon la revendication 8, caractérisé en ce que la DEL (18) est placée, avec interposition d'une pellicule munie de pistes conductrices, directement sur une zone support réalisée par le boitier de monture.
  10. Moyen d'éclairage selon la revendication 9, caractérisé en ce que l'électronique de fonctionnement pour la DEL (18) forme elle-même une unité de montage avec la DEL (18).
  11. Moyen d'éclairage selon l'une des revendications 4, 5 ou 7, caractérisé en ce que la bague d'accouplement (22) sert en tant que pont thermique pour l'évacuation de la chaleur du corps de monture (11) vers d'autres parties de la lampe.
  12. Moyen d'éclairage selon l'une des précédentes revendications, caractérisé en ce que le corps de monture (11) présente un raccordement pour un conducteur de protection.
